The Water Transmission System consists of:
 Al Taif Pump Station ARADA (2 sets of pumps, flow rates 636 l/sec. and heads 370, 160 m)
 Reservoirs of (Al Baha, Shuhada, Sudyrah, Shugsan, Gazail, & Mandaq) with capacities from 1500 to 140, 000m3
 Transmission main pipe line of diameter 1000 mm from steel pipes with total length about 217 km
 The water transmission system is capable of transferring 80, 000 cubic meters of potable desalinated water per day along a 217 km pipeline between the cities of Al Taif and Al Baha, where it will be connected to the local water network for distribution throughout the province of Al Baha
